Playing with Resin

Instructor: Tracy Wilkerson

Thursday | July 7, 2022 | 6:00-9:00 pm | all levels* | $52 (includes supplies) | resin | Falls Church Arts Gallery (work created during the class will need to dry and must be picked up later that week, during gallery hours)

Learn the ins and outs of prepping for and mixing resin and how to use it as an adhesive, a covering, or the main medium. There’s lots of creative time during this 3-hour workshop … no need to rush, which is one of the first lessons in using resin! This workshop does not get into using dyes with resin or building big molds to create one-of-a-kind resined tables (as seen on YouTube), but it will provide you with a good understanding of how resin works so you can be bold enough to take the next steps in your creative interests.

Tracy Wilkerson is a mixed-media artist who has used resin in her artwork since 2007. “I kept getting questions about how to work with resin, so a few years later, I created this workshop to answer those questions as well as provide a safe environment to learn how resin works.”
